Aktivitas antibakteri sabun transparan dengan penambahan ekstrak kulit nanas [Antibacterial activity of transparent soap with addition of pineapple peel extract]
The ability of pineapple peel extract to inhibit Staphylococcus aureus thus it can be applied to a transparent soap.  The effect of pineapple peel extract addition in the inhibitory effect on the growth of Staphylococcus aureus bacteria and quality of transparent soap was studied.  The study used a complete randomized design with five treatments and three replications.  The data was statistically analyzed using ANOVA and continued with DNMRT at the level of 5%.  The treatments were different concentrations of pineapple peel extract addition: 0%, 1,5%, 2%, 2,5%, and 3% in the transparent soap.  The result showed that the variations of pineapple peel extract addition in the making of the transparent soap significantly affected antibacterial activity, water content, amount of fatty acids, free alkali, pH, foam stability, and sensory test.  The selected treatment from this study was 3% addition of pineapple peel extract.  Transparent soap from this treatment had 11.47% water content, 35.35% total fatty acid, 0.22% free alkali, 10.07 degree of acidity, 73.30% foam stability, and 26.36 mm antibacterial activity against S. aureus.  The descriptive test showed that the transparent soap had hard texture, dark brown color, pineapple flavor, and rather transparent.
